Before we check what’s lined up in December, here is a quick recap of top achievements by Indian sportspersons in November:

  1. India wins maiden Women’s ODI World Cup!
  2. Lakshya Sen won Australian Open (BWF 500).
  3. Indian shooters put up a fantastic show at World Pistol/Rifle World Championship. They won 6 medals: 1 🥇 3 🥈 2 🥉

Cricket

In Men’s cricket, India will play a 3 ODI & 5 T20 series against South Africa.

ODI Series: 30 Nov, 3 Dec, 6 Dec
T20 Series: 9 Dec, 11 Dec, 14 Dec, 17 Dec and 19 Dec

In Women’s cricket, India is slated to play Sri Lanka in a 5 match T20 series.

5 T20s: Visakhapatnam (Dec 21 & 23), Thiruvananthapuram (Dec 26, 28 & 30).

Table Tennis

2 big events scheduled in Table Tennis:

30 Nov – 7 Dec: ITTF Mixed Team World Cup
10-14 Dec: WTT Finals 2025

Diya & Manush have qualified for WTT Finals in the Mixed Doubles event.

Badminton

17-21 Dec: 2025 BWF World Tour Finals

Satwik/Chirag have qualified for the World Tour finals in Men’s Doubles.

Squash

India will be hosting Squash World Cup between 9-14 December.

Hockey

Indian Men’s Hockey team will be touring South Africa between 1-15 December for a 5 match series.

Fencing

Following events are scheduled in Fencing:

Sabre Grand Prix France: 4-6 Dec
Epee World Cup Canada: 4-7 Dec
Foil World Cup Male Japan: 5-7 Dec
Foil World Cup Female Korea: 5-7 Dec

Boxing

2025 World Men’s Boxing Championsip is scheduled in UAE between 2-13 December.

Track Cycling

India will have its National Track Cycling Championships in Uttarkhand between 19-24 December.
